About Updo Specialist

After the appointment and removal

Most updos last 6 to 12 hours with light touching up. Removal should be done by gently twisting out pins, never yanking, then washing with a clarifying shampoo to remove spray build up. Use a wide tooth comb on damp hair and a deep conditioner the next day to restore moisture lost from tension and styling.

How to check their training

Ask where they trained and how long they have been styling updos full-time. Cosmetology licensing is required in most states, but updo skill is rarely tested in licensing exams. Look for specialized bridal or editorial training, photos of finished styles on real clients, and reviews mentioning hold time and comfort after several hours of wear.

What hair length actually works

Classic updos need at least shoulder-length hair, ideally mid-back or longer for complex styles. Chin-length hair limits options to half-up designs or styles with extensions. Discuss your hair length honestly before booking. A skilled specialist can extend short hair with clip-ins or a bun padding, but results vary based on your natural density and texture.

How long the appointment takes

Plan 45 to 75 minutes for a single updo with clean, dry hair. Add 20 to 30 minutes if the specialist must curl, backcomb, or section very thick hair. Traveling to your venue adds travel and setup time, often 30 minutes per stylist. Confirm the arrival window the day before to avoid rushed styling under time pressure.

What usually goes wrong

Loose pins are the most common complaint, especially with heavy or layered hair. Curls falling flat within 2 hours often means too much product or skipping the cool-down phase after curling. Tension headaches happen when styles are pulled too tight. Ask the specialist to walk you through the hold plan and pin placement during the trial.

Pricing and what changes the number

A standard updo at a salon runs 60 to 120 dollars. Bridal or event-day styling ranges from 100 to 300 dollars. Travel fees add 25 to 100 dollars depending on distance. Complex braided styles, added extensions, or last-minute bookings cost more. Ask for a written quote listing each line item so you can compare specialists fairly.

Hair length and texture that hold best

Shoulder length or longer hair gives the most reliable hold because there is more to pin and braid. Chin length cuts can work with added pieces or strong products. Very curly, very fine or freshly bleached hair often needs extra prep time, added structure or extra hold spray to keep shape for hours.

How long the appointment takes

Plan 45 to 75 minutes for one simple updo, and 90 to 150 minutes for layered braids, volume work or attached accessories. Add 20 to 30 minutes if the specialist is also doing your makeup. Travel time, parking and setup are usually billed separately and should be confirmed in writing before the day.
